Feeling like a novice at the Christian life means you’re right where grace begins—learning strength through Christ!
“I have learned in whatever situation I am to be content” (Philippians 4:11b).
Want to hear a comforting thought? Paul didn’t magically just know how to be content in abasement or abundance. It wasn’t a sanctification super suit handed to him by a Holy Spirit Howard Stark when he joined the Apostolic Avengers. He had to learn it.
Later in verse 12, he says it again: “I have learned the secret of facing plenty and hunger, abundance and need.” That means it was hard at first. Confusing. He messed it up early on. But as he pressed onward, not giving up on his Savior's power and willingness to save, not quitting when he got it wrong or missed the mark, Paul learned “I can do all things through him who strengthens me” (Phil. 4:13).
As you seek to follow Jesus today, you might feel like a baby who can’t walk. Or a rookie who’s missing all the signals. And guess what? That means you are perfectly qualified to learn contentment alongside Paul, under the strengthening smile of your Heavenly Father. Because it’s there, in the place of need, where the grace of Christ meets you. And as you receive His Word by faith and draw near to Him in the ordinary rhythms of grace, you’ll find what Paul found: that we can do all things through Christ.
